Kinds of Personal Injury Cases and Their Unique Challenges

Personal injury cases include a broad spectrum of incidents, each creating different challenges for victims and their attorneys. Car accidents, for instance, often entail complex insurance claims and liability disputes, making it vital to collect evidence quickly. Medical malpractice cases demand comprehensive knowledge of healthcare standards and necessitate expert testimony, introducing layers of complexity.

Product liability cases can be quite difficult, as they necessitate proving that a product was faulty and caused injury, often involving large corporations with significant resources. Slip and fall cases depend on proving negligence, which can be challenging if the property owner disputes responsibility.

Workplace incidents may concern workers' compensation complaints, where the employee must navigate specific regulations. Each type of case necessitates tailored strategies to effectively champion the victim, stressing the critical nature of understanding these unique challenges to ensure just compensation.

Techniques to Improve Your Rewards Following an Accident

Maximizing compensation after an accident requires strategic planning and comprehensive record-keeping. People should start by collecting all pertinent information, including photos of the accident location, eyewitness accounts, and medical records. This documentation acts as essential backing for any claims made to insurance companies.

Consulting with a compassionate injury counsel is essential; they can handle intricate legal matters and represent the injured person. Additionally, it's necessary to keep a detailed account of all expenditures from the accident, such as treatment costs, forfeited earnings, and rehabilitation costs.

Victims should avoid making premature statements to insurance adjusters, as these can compromise their claims. Finally, understanding the statute of limitations for submitting claims guarantees timely action, maintaining the right to pursue compensation. By implementing these strategies, victims can maximize their chances of obtaining fair compensation for their damages and losses.

Frequently Requested Questions

How What Amount Will a Physical Injury Counsel Typically Charge?

Personal injury attorneys typically charge between 25% to 40% of the awarded settlement as contingency fees. This means clients pay nothing unless they win, making attorney services more accessible for those in need.

What Ought to I Bring to My Starting Appointment?

For your initial consultation, individuals should assemble relevant documents such as accident reports, medical records, insurance information, and any correspondence related to the incident. This information supports the lawyer assess the case successfully.

How long does a bodily harm claim typically require?

A personal injury case typically takes anywhere from a few months to several years to resolve, depending on factors like case complexity, negotiation processes, and judicial calendars, determining the overall timeline considerably.

Is It Possible to Receive Damages if I Was Partially at Fault?

Yes, individuals can still claim compensation if partially at fault, as many legal systems allow for comparative fault. Compensation may be lowered based on the percentage of fault assigned to the injured party during the case.

What Takes Place if the Insurance Company Declines My Claim?

If an underwriter denies a claim, the individual may dispute the decision, deliver supplemental material, or pursue professional guidance. Exploring alternative dispute resolution avenues or pursuing litigation can also be probable next courses of action for compensation.
